Docs Menu
Docs Home
/
MongoDB Cloud Manager
/

복제본 세트를 샤딩된 클러스터로 변환하세요.

이 페이지의 내용

  • MongoDB Cloud Manager 에서 프로젝트 의 Deployment 페이지로 Go 합니다.
  • Processes 페이지로 이동합니다.
  • 배포서버 에 대한 Clusters 보기를 선택합니다.
  • 원하는 복제본 세트를 변환합니다.
  • 새 샤드 cluster에 대한 세부 정보를 제공합니다.
  • Convert를 클릭합니다.
  • 복제본 세트 대신 mongos 프로세스에 연결하도록 애플리케이션을 수정합니다.
  • 클러스터 전체 설정을 변경합니다.

Cloud Manager는 복제본 세트샤드 클러스터로 변환하는 기능을 제공합니다.

1
  1. 이미 표시되어 있지 않은 경우 탐색 모음의 Organizations 메뉴에서 원하는 프로젝트가 포함된 조직을 선택합니다.

  2. 아직 표시되지 않은 경우 탐색 표시줄의 Projects 메뉴에서 원하는 프로젝트를 선택합니다.

  3. Deployment 페이지가 아직 표시되지 않은 경우 사이드바에서 Deployment를 클릭합니다.

    배포 페이지가 표시됩니다.

2

배포서버 의 Processes 탭 을 클릭합니다.

프로세스 페이지가 표시됩니다.

3
4

다음에서 메뉴에서 원하는 복제본 세트 Convert to Sharded Cluster 를 클릭합니다.

5

Provide details for your new sharded cluster 모달에서 다음 설정을 구성합니다.

  1. 샤드 클러스터 구성 요소의 이름을 지정합니다.

    필드
    작업

    Cluster Name

    새 cluster의 이름을 입력합니다.

    CSRS Name

    CSRS 의 이름을 입력합니다.

    참고

    Convert 을 클릭한 후에는 이 값을 변경할 수 없습니다.

  2. Config Servers 의 각 mongod 프로세스에 대해 다음 값을 설정합니다. 모든 필드는 필수 입력 사항입니다.

    참고

    하나 이상의 구성 서버를 배포해야 합니다.

    필드
    작업

    Host Name

    메뉴에서 기존 호스트 이름을 선택하거나 목록 위의 검색 상자에 호스트 이름을 입력하여 호스트를 찾습니다.

    새 호스트를 추가해야 하는 경우:

    1. New Server 링크를 클릭합니다.

    2. Next를 클릭합니다.

    3. 지침에 따라 해당 새 호스트에 새 자동화를 설치합니다.

    4. Verify Agent를 클릭합니다.

    Port

    IANA 포트 번호를 입력합니다.

    Data Directory

    mongod 에 대한 데이터베이스 파일의 절대 디렉토리 경로를 입력합니다.

    예시 경로는 /data 입니다.

    mongod 은(는) 지정된 호스트에서 이러한 경로를 배타적으로 사용해야 합니다. Cloud Manager 자동화에는 이 디렉토리의 모든 파일과 폴더를 읽고, 쓰고, 실행할 수 있는 파일 시스템 권한이 있어야 합니다.

    Log File

    mongod 에 대한 로그 파일의 절대 파일 경로를 입력합니다.

    예시 경로는 /data/mongodb.log 입니다.

    mongod 은(는) 지정된 호스트에서 이러한 경로를 배타적으로 사용해야 합니다. Cloud Manager 자동화에는 이 디렉토리의 모든 파일과 폴더를 읽고, 쓰고, 실행할 수 있는 파일 시스템 권한이 있어야 합니다.

    참고

    config 서버 추가 또는 제거

    • 새 구성 서버를 추가하려면 Add a Config Server 을(를) 클릭합니다.

    • config 서버를 제거하려면 다음을 클릭합니다. 제거하려는 config 서버의 오른쪽에 있는

  3. 샤드 클러스터 의 각 MongoS 프로세스에 대해 다음 값을 설정합니다. 모든 필드는 필수 입력 사항입니다.

    참고

    필드
    작업

    Host Name

    메뉴에서 기존 호스트 이름을 선택하거나 목록 위의 검색 상자에 호스트 이름을 입력하여 호스트를 찾습니다.

    새 호스트를 추가해야 하는 경우:

    1. New Server 링크를 클릭합니다.

    2. Next를 클릭합니다.

    3. 지침에 따라 해당 새 호스트에 새 자동화를 설치합니다.

    4. Verify Agent를 클릭합니다.

    Port

    IANA 포트 번호를 입력합니다.

    Log File

    mongos 프로세스의 로그에 대한 abolute 파일 경로를 입력합니다.

    예시 경로는 /data/mongodb.log 입니다.

    mongos 은(는) 지정된 호스트에서 이러한 경로를 배타적으로 사용해야 합니다. Cloud Manager 자동화에는 이 디렉토리의 모든 파일과 폴더를 읽고, 쓰고, 실행할 수 있는 파일 시스템 권한이 있어야 합니다.

    참고

    Mongo 샤드 라우터 추가 또는 제거

    • mongos 를 추가하려면 Add a MongoS 를 클릭합니다.

    • mongos 을(를) 제거하려면 다음을 클릭합니다. 제거하려는 mongos 오른쪽에 있습니다.

6
7

Cloud Manager UI에서 다음을 클릭합니다. 아이콘을 클릭한 다음 Connect to this instance 을 클릭합니다. Connect to your Deployment 대화 상자는 클러스터에 있는 mongos 의 호스트 이름과 포트를 제공합니다.

Cloud Manager 배포서버에 연결하는 방법에 대한 전체 문서 는 MongoDB 프로세스에 연결을참조하세요.

8

샤드 클러스터 를 추가로 변경하려면 배포 구성 편집 페이지의 Sharded Cluster 탭을 참조하세요.

복제본 세트를 shard cluster로 변환한 후 데이터베이스 및 shard collection에 대해 샤딩을 활성화할 수 있습니다.

컬렉션을 샤딩하는 방법을 알아보려면 컬렉션 샤딩을 참조하세요 .

더 큰 용량을 지원하기 위해 추가 샤드를 추가해야 하는 경우 샤드 cluster의 렌치 메뉴를 클릭하여 추가 샤드를 생성합니다.

참고

변환 후 백업에 미치는 영향

변환된 샤드(원본 복제본 세트)에는 다음이 포함됩니다.

  • backupEnabled

  • 이전 스냅샷 보존

  • 이 샤드에만 스냅샷을 복원하는 기능

변환한 후에는 전체 샤드 클러스터에 대해 백업을 활성화 해야 합니다. MongoDB FCV 4.0 이하 버전을 실행하는 데이터베이스에서 백업을 활성화하면 Cloud Manager가 구성 서버와 변환된 샤드에서 초기 동기화를 시작합니다. 전체 샤드 클러스터에 대한 복원은 변환 후에 만든 스냅샷만 사용해야 합니다.

돌아가기

독립형에서 복제본 세트로의 은밀한 설정